Molecules 2004, 9, 860-866 molecules ISSN 1420-3049 Synthesis and Spectroscopic Characterization of New Schiff Bases Containing the Benzo-15-Crown-5 Moiety Zeliha Hayvalı 1,*, Mustafa Hayvalı 1 and Hakan Dal 2 1Ankara University, Department of Chemistry, Faculty of Science, 06100, Tandoğan, Ankara, Turkey. 2Anadolu University, Department of Chemistry, Faculty of Science, Eskişehir, Turkey. * Author to whom correspondence should be addressed; e-mail: zhayvali@.tr; Tel: (+90) 3122126720. Received: 4 June 2004 / Accepted: 19 July 2004 / Published: 30 September 2004 Abstract: New crown ether Schiff base derivatives were prepared by the condensation of 4’-formylbenzo-15-crown-5 or 4’-formyl-5’-hydroxybenzo-15-crown-5 with 1,2-bis(2- aminophenoxy)ethane. The structures of these new compounds were confirmed on the basis of elemental analysis, IR, 1H- and 13C-NMR, UV-Vis and mass spectroscopic data. Keywords: Crown ether, Schiff base, Spectroscopy. Introduction Macrocyclic polyethers like crown ethers have received much attention in the last few years, both in chemistry and in biology [1-3]. Some crown ethers play an important role in membrane separation processes [4], fibre optic chemical sensor properties [5] and phase transfer catalysis [6,7]. In addition, owing to the recognition of the complexation properties of macrocyclic polyethers with alkali, alkaline-earth metal cations and uncharged organic molecules, considerable work has been done in the macrocyclic polyethers area [8-10].
